Hi Priya,

Welcome to the Lanternfall on-call rotation. Please review the canary gating rules before your first shift: promotions are blocked unless error rate stays under 0.3% for 30 minutes, and any auth-path regression triggers an automatic rollback regardless of other signals. Manual overrides require a second approver from the security rotation and are logged for audit. The complete gating policy, including override procedures, is documented on the internal page below.

runbook for badug-kadup: https://confluence.zemvarlabs.internal/projects/browse/display/projects/bd1b

Quick reminder for anyone booking guests into the Brightloop recording studio: all visitors need to be signed in at the Kestrel House front desk and walked up personally — no exceptions, even for regulars. Keep chatter low in the corridor when the red light's on. To let your visitor through the studio door, use the pass below.

staff pass of kawip-hawef = bdg-QLP-2

Changed defaults in Proctorline's exam-proctoring queue, effective next release. Max concurrent sessions per proctor dropped from 12 to 8 after the Fernvale pilot showed review quality degrading past 9. Idle-session eviction shortened to 15 minutes. Flagged-event escalation now routes to the senior pool by default instead of round-robin. Retry backoff on webhook delivery doubled. No schema changes. Dashboards updated. Rollback is a single flag flip. The new default configuration block follows.

deployment values, faduf-tawep:
SORDOR_LOG_LEVEL=error
SORDOR_METRICS_HOST=metrics.sordor.nelvrolabs.internal
SORDOR_POOL_SIZE=4